				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>It has been confirmed that Bruce Springsteen &amp; The E Street Band will come to the UK next year to perform a series of live shows, the tour will mark Springsteen and the full band’s first UK show since 2016. The Boss and the band are set to start their UK tour on Tuesday 30th May 2023 with a set at Edinburgh’s BT Murrayfield Stadium. The second stop of the tour sees the band perform at Birmingham’s Villa Park on Friday 16th June 2023, the tour concludes with a two-day residency at London’s Hyde Park on Thursday 6th and Saturday 8th July 2023.</p>

<p>After the completion of the tour’s US leg, the group will descend on Ireland and play three shows at Dublin’s RDS Arena on 5th, 7th and 9th May 2023. Following their Ireland shows, the band will kick off the European leg of the tour with a set at Italian venue Parco Urbano Bassani on 18<sup>th</sup> May 2023, after five more European dates the band’s first UK set of their tour is held. The extensive global tour is scheduled to conclude on 25th July 2023, the influential singer and band will finish their tour with a performance at Italy’s Autodromo Nazionale.</p>
<p>Springsteen recently made headlines for his surprise appearance at last month’s Glastonbury Festival, the “<em>Born In The USA</em>” singer joined fellow rocker Paul McCartney on stage during the former Beatles’ set. During the now legendary performance, Springsteen treated the audience to his hit “<em>Glory Days</em>” and teamed up with McCartney to perform the Beatles classic “<em>I Wanna Be Your Man</em>”. Later on during the event, Springsteen made a return to the Pyramid Stage to join Foo Fighters frontman Dave Grohl for a performance of “<em>The End</em>”.</p>
<p>McCartney performed his headlining slot at the Pyramid Stage on 25th June 2022 and was also joined by Grohl, after the completion of “<em>Get Back</em>” the singer motioned to the former Nirvana drummer to join him on stage. The “<em>Come Together</em>” singer <a href="https://www.nme.com/news/music/paul-mccartney-dave-grohl-bruce-springsteen-glastonbury-2022-setlist-footage-3255915">said</a> to the roaring crowd, “<em>Now, I’ve got a little surprise for you, your hero from the west coast of America – Dave Grohl!</em>” After the pair exchanged pleasantries, they performed “<em>I Saw You Standing There</em>” and “<em>Band On The Run</em>” The live collaboration marked the first time that Grohl had been seen on stage since the tragic passing of his bandmate and friend Taylor Hawkins.</p>

				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Kasabian, the indie rock band from Leicester, is still going strong despite the departure of Tom Meighan – their previous frontman, back in 2020. Today they survive with Sergio Pizzorno (their chief songwriter) as the new frontman, Tim Carter on guitar, Chris Edwards on bass, and Ian Matthews on drums. And as if to prove they can survive the changed line-up, they’ve released their latest single today, with talks of a new album (<em>The Alchemist&#8217;s Euphoria</em>) lined up for August 5<sup>th</sup><em>.</em></p>
<p>As for the new single (it’s called “<em>SCRIPTVRE</em>“ by the way), it was produced by Pizzorno and Stormzy/Adele/Sam Smith collaborator Fraser T Smith. Pizzorno <a href="https://www.nme.com/news/music/kasabian-scripture-alchemists-euphoria-interview-serge-pizzorno-liam-gallagher-3219841">says of the track’s themes that</a> “<em>We all make up this narrative of who we think we are. This is about ripping that up, going against all that and no longer going with your own madness. You need to go somewhere else and re-set everything.</em><em>”</em></p>
<p>Pizzorno <a href="https://www.nme.com/news/music/kasabian-scripture-alchemists-euphoria-interview-serge-pizzorno-liam-gallagher-3219841">describes the track’s overall sound as</a> “<em>huge</em>“, which “<em>came from me bouncing off Kanye and old ‘70s soul cuts from digging in crates. There’s a euphoric, beautiful arms-in-the-air moment then goes back to this ferocious, heavy beat. It’s in your face.”</em><br />

				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Scottish indie rock band The Snuts and South London singer-songwriter Rachel Chinouriri have collaborated on the former’s latest single, “<em>End of the Road</em>“, which can be heard down below. The track was produced in London’s Abbey Road Studios by Detonate and Coffee.<br />
<iframe title="YouTube video player" src="https://www.youtube.com/embed/kcsVnr-oXZI" width="956" height="538" frameborder="0" allowfullscreen="allowfullscreen"></iframe><br />
According to The Snuts frontman Jack Cochrane, <a href="https://www.nme.com/news/music/listen-to-the-snuts-and-rachel-chinouriri-team-up-on-end-of-the-road-radar-3218965">the song is</a> “<em>A remedy for heartache. We wanted the track to be direct and truly versify a sense of self-forgiveness and redemption.” </em>And as for their special guest vocalist, “<em>The soothing tones of our friend Rachel Chinouriri, who features heavily in the song, helps inject an almost confessional burst of light throughout.</em>”</p>
<p>It sounds like Chinouriri was happy with the result as well, <a href="https://www.nme.com/news/music/listen-to-the-snuts-and-rachel-chinouriri-team-up-on-end-of-the-road-radar-3218965">saying that the song</a> “<em>came about quite spontaneously, which is sometimes how the best things come about. I really loved it when I first heard it and when I met the boys the lyrics and melody came to us so naturally.” </em></p>
<p>Of course, Chinouriri hasn’t been shy about her own material lately, planning her third EP to follow up 2021’s <em>Four° In Winter. </em>You can also hear her latest single “<em>All I Ever Asked</em>“ down below.<br />
<iframe title="YouTube video player" src="https://www.youtube.com/embed/2QXSnc_9OuU" width="717" height="538" frameborder="0" allowfullscreen="allowfullscreen"></iframe><br />
&#8220;<em>End of the Road</em>&#8221; comes about as The Snuts continue to work on their next LP, following their 2021 debut W.L.. However, the record’s a bit of a tall order to follow up with, considering it was the first debut from a Scottish band to debut at number 1 on the <a href="https://www.officialcharts.com/artist/56289/snuts/">UK Albums Chart</a> for over a decade; but hopefully they’ve got some tricks up their sleeve for when the next one comes out.</p>

The two met when Righton was helping put together the live band for ABBA’s upcoming Voyage shows in London in celebration of their latest LP. Starting on May 27<sup>th</sup> in the new ABBA Arena, the show will have the group appearing virtually beside the live band that Righton has helped to build.</p>
<p>He was brought into the project by Johan Renck (director of Bowie’s &#8220;<em>Blackstar</em>&#8221; video) and couldn’t really turn down the opportunity, working in secret for two years with one of the most iconic bands of the seventies. <a href="https://www.nme.com/news/music/james-righton-shares-new-song-empty-rooms-with-abbas-benny-andersson-3213548">He admitted that</a> “<em>trying not to say anything to anyone is quite hard when you’re working with such a legendary act like ABBA”.</em></p>
<p>Righton was of course keen to make the most of the opportunity, noting that the very mention of working with ABBA <a href="https://www.nme.com/news/music/james-righton-shares-new-song-empty-rooms-with-abbas-benny-andersson-3213548">made his jaw drop</a>. “<em>Whenever you hear an ABBA reunion rumour it just feels so unbelievable.” </em>On working with Andersson for his new track, he said Andersson had “<em>never done anything like this before. I nervously sent him the track and a couple of days later he sent back this keyboard line which was perfect.”</em></p>
<p><a href="https://www.nme.com/news/music/james-righton-shares-new-song-empty-rooms-with-abbas-benny-andersson-3213548">As for the song itself;</a> “<em>Empty Rooms’ is about silent conflicts. It’s about realising one’s own flaws and working through them. Like all the songs on the album it reflects another side of life during lockdown.”</em><br />
<iframe title="YouTube video player" src="https://www.youtube.com/embed/mPMkqFNzvhc" width="888" height="500" frameborder="0" allowfullscreen="allowfullscreen"></iframe><br />
Righton, who used to be a member of Klaxons until the group disbanded back in 2015, has been working on a variety of projects as of late. Some of these have been released under the name of Shock Machine, and he’s even been having a go at film soundtracks recently (e.g. 2019’s <em>Benjamin</em>).</p>

				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Welsh singer Gwenno (Gwenno Mererid Saunders) has released the latest single from her upcoming album, <em>Tresor, </em>which is due out on July 1<sup>st</sup> via Heavenly Recordings. It’s the second release from the new album, following on from February’s “<em>An Stevel Nowydh</em>“, and it’s called “<em>Men An Toll</em>“. You can listen to the new track below.<br />
<iframe title="YouTube video player" src="https://www.youtube.com/embed/uOWgBnd4_iA" width="956" height="538" frameborder="0" allowfullscreen="allowfullscreen"></iframe><br />
After having sung in indie girl group The Pipettes for around five years, Gwenno’s been working hard on her solo career, with<em> Tresor</em> about to become her third full-length studio release. As for the new creative freedom that comes from a solo career, the land of Cornwall seems to be a big inspiration for her at the moment, something she&#8217;s exploring at all lengths.</p>
<p>Having grown up with a Welsh-speaking Mum and a Cornish speaking Dad, Gwenno is fluent in both languages. It’s something that came to the fore in her 2018 album <em>Le Kov, </em>which was sung entirely in Cornish. That continues to be the case here, with the Mên-an-Tol standing stones in Cornwall being the inspiration behind this song.</p>
<p><a href="https://www.nme.com/news/music/listen-to-gwennos-dreamy-new-track-men-an-toll-3201409">Gwenno explains that</a> “<em>I was inspired by Ithell Colquhoun’s ‘The Living Stones’ as well as the eternal nature of these ancient monuments and how they enable us to reflect on our own nature as human beings and on our relationship to the landscape</em><em> …. I wanted to share a different and quieter side to the record, one that is grounded in … ambient Celtic music, film scores, and experimental electronic music …. I hope that this collection of songs will serve as a small and helpful reminder of how powerful the sound of gentleness and beauty is.</em>“</p>

The album was written before the lockdown and completed in Gwenno&#8217;s Cardiff home with Rhys Edwards producing, and its release will be accompanied by a short film made by Gwenno and filmmaker Clare Marie Bailey. The record’s <a href="https://www.nme.com/news/music/listen-to-gwennos-dreamy-new-track-men-an-toll-3201409">promised to be</a> “<em>an introspective focus on home and self, a prescient work echoing the isolation and retreat that has been a central, global shared experience over the past two years.</em>“</p>

				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Nova Twins, the alternative-rock duo from London, have just released the latest single from their upcoming new album <em>Supernova. </em>The single is called “<em>Cleopatra</em>“ and is the third taster of what they’ve been getting up to the past two years, following up 2020’s acclaimed <em>Who Are the Girls?. </em>Other recent singles include last November’s “<em>Antagonist</em>“ and February’s “<em>K. M. B</em>“, an initialism of the apparently common phrase Kill My Boyfriend (for those of you not in the know).</p>
<p>This latest track was inspired by the rise of Black Lives Matter, something especially important to the Nova Twins. Both Amy Love (vocals/guitar) and Georgia South (bass) are mixed-race, with <a href="https://www.nme.com/news/music/nova-twins-preview-new-album-supernova-with-the-powerful-cleopatra-3183563">Love explaining that</a> “<em>Cleopatra’ was written off the back of the Black Lives Matter protests. Attending them made us feel powerful as two mixed-race women in an era where people were suddenly waking up to Anti Racists conversations. It’s about celebrating who we are and being proud of where we come from. We hope this song encourages people from all walks of life to act and feel the same way too.”</em><br />
<iframe title="YouTube video player" src="https://www.youtube.com/embed/BfqaPLU_epQ" width="956" height="538" frameborder="0" allowfullscreen="allowfullscreen"></iframe><br />
The album as a whole will probably have a range of topics to deal with, at least judging by songs like “<em>K. M. B</em>” getting their say. But one thing that really helped shape its development (and that of most music at the moment) was the pandemic. <a href="https://www.nme.com/news/music/nova-twins-preview-new-album-supernova-with-the-powerful-cleopatra-3183563">The band have said that</a> “<em>‘Supernova’ is the beginning of a new era</em><em>. </em><em>As we delved into the unknown, making this album became our medicine through a turbulent time</em><em> …. </em><em>It’s a journey of lockdown and coming out the other end a winner. We’re really excited.</em> “</p>
